Couple killed in double shooting at Simi Valley home

A husband and wife were killed Sunday following a double shooting at their Simi Valley home, authorities said.

Simi Valley police responded to a shooting call just after 12 p.m. at a neighborhood in Hawks Bill Place near Wood Ranch Parkway.

Officers arrived and found the two victims with multiple gunshot wounds in the garage of the home, according to Simi Valley police. Both victims were transported to a nearby hospital, where they succumbed to their injuries.

Police described the victims as a woman and a man in their 60s. An employer identified the married couple as Dr. Eric Cordes and his wife, Vicki.

“The Adventist Health Simi Valley community is heartbroken by the tragic deaths of our longtime colleague, Dr. Eric Cordes, and his wife, Vicki. Dr. Cordes was a highly respected, board-certified radiologist and beloved physician who served this community with compassion and excellence for nearly 30 years. Our hearts are with his family, friends, and all who had the privilege of working alongside him as we grieve this shocking loss,” wrote Adventist Health Simi Valley in a statement to NBCLA.

Simi Valley police believe the shooting to be an isolated incident. A motive for the shooting is unclear.

Neighbors told police they witnessed a man get out of a vehicle and fire several rounds. No arrests have been made.

Simi Valley detectives are working alongside investigators in Chino regarding a death by suicide and car fire at Ayala Park in San Bernardino County. It’s unclear whether the investigation is connected to the double homicide.
